About Sarah Miller

Sarah Miller is a scholar working on Psychiatry and Mental health, Microbiology and Acoustics and Ultrasonics, having authored 96 papers that have together received 1.1k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Migraine and Headache Studies (21 papers), Trigeminal Neuralgia and Treatments (17 papers) and Early Childhood Education and Development (17 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Psychiatry and Mental health (483 citations), Pathology and Forensic Medicine (379 citations) and Physiology (301 citations). Sarah Miller has collaborated with scholars based in United Kingdom, United States and Ireland. Frequent co-authors include Manjit Matharu, Laurence Watkins, Susie Lagrata, Paul Connolly, Ludvic Zrinzo, Harith Akram, Allen Thurston, Marwan Hariz, Giorgio Lambru and Lisa Maguire. Their work appears in journals such as The Lancet, S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ología and Journal of Geophysical Research Atmospheres.
